Emigrate is the debut studio album by the industrial rock band Emigrate. It was released on August 31, 2007 in Europe and on January 29, 2008 in the United States and in Australia via Motor Music. Recording sessions took place at Puk Recording Studios in Denmark. Production was handled by Richard Kruspe with Jacob Hellner, Arnaud Giroux and Olsen Involtini.

Personnel

  • Richard Kruspe – lyrics, guitars, vocals, producer
  • Caron Bernstein – lyrics
  • Margaux Bossieux – backing vocals (tracks: 2, 3, 6, 7, 9)
  • Grace Risch – backing vocals (track 11)
  • Ruth Renner – backing vocals (track 11)
  • Arnaud Giroux – bass, vocal recording and production, co-producer
  • Olsen Involtini – additional guitar, vocal recording and production, co-producer
  • Henka Johansson – drums
  • Sascha Moser – programming (Logic and Pro Tools)
  • Ulf Kruckenberg – drum engineering
  • Jacob Hellner – co-producer
  • Stefan Glaumann – mixing
  • Howie Weinbergmastering
  • Dirk Rudolph – design
  • Felix Broede – photography
